Courtney, Thomas Farrell

  • Saturday, February 6, 2016

Thomas Farrell Courtney 73, of Ooltewah, died on Friday, February 5, 2016.

He was a lifelong resident of the Chattanooga area and served in the U.S. Navy during Vietnam.

Survivors include his son, Jason Courtney a daughter, Janice (John) Lepikko, four grandchildren, Kayla Ellison, Paul Allan Courtney, Patrick Lepikko, Kristine Lepikko, and four great-grandchildren, Harmony Lepikko, Brook Lepikko, Korey Lepikko, and Brianna Sisson.

At Tom’s request there will be no visitation or services.

Please visit www.heritagechattanooga.com to share words of comfort to the family.

Arrangements are by Heritage Funeral Home, 7454 East Brainerd Road.
